In 2020-2021, 33 degrees and certificates were awarded to curriculum and instruction students who went to a Maine college or university. This makes it the #90 most popular major in the state.

Our 2023 rankings named University of Southern Maine the most popular school in Maine for curriculum and instruction students working on their master’s degree. Located in the city of Portland, University of Southern Maine is a public college with a moderately-sized student population.
Women make up 87% of the curriculum majors at the school.
